About this property

Nikko Senhime Monogatari

Comfortable hotel, walk to Toshogu Shrine
Nikko Senhime Monogatari offers its guests hot springs, an indoor pool, and Access to hot tub. A computer station is on site and WiFi is free in public spaces. You can enjoy a drink at the bar/lounge. A sauna, a vending machine, and karaoke are also featured at Nikko Senhime Monogatari. Self parking is free.

Nikko Senhime Monogatari offers 44 air-conditioned accommodations with minibars and a safe. Fridges and coffee/tea makers are provided. Bathrooms include bidets, complimentary toiletries and hairdryers.

Flat-screen televisions come with digital channels. Business-friendly amenities include desks, complimentary newspapers and telephones. Housekeeping is offered on a daily basis and in-room massages can be requested.

Services include massages. Public bath/onsen services include an indoor mineral hot spring (onsen) and yukata (Japanese robe). These services feature separate men's and women's areas. There are hot springs on site.

  • As required by the Japanese Ministry of Health, Labour and Welfare, all international visitors must submit their passport number and nationality when registering at any lodging facility (inns, hotels, motels etc). Also, it's required that lodging proprietors photocopy the passports of all registering guests and keep the photocopy on file.

Amazing
This hotel provides fantastic service. I was initially a little bit worried about the japanese style room (no beds) but it was comfortable. Their spa was clean and more spacious than what I expected. There are several tubs outside as well, which was really cool. The food was amazing. The breakfast and dinner were served in a private room. The best part was that the room had a riverview and we could open the window. We left the windows open throughout the night and the sound of the river was really surreal.

A Japanese Dream vacation
My wife and I are are American Tourist in our early 60's We got to the hotel at 11:30 AM, exhausted and suffer from jet lag. We found that (1) almost no one spoke any english, (2) no one is allowed in the rooms until 3:00 PM, (3) we could not exchange cash or credit for Japanese Yen. The location was great - right across from the Temples - but it was pouring rain. We finally got to our room - but there are no beds! We found the mats and traditional mattresses, piled them in the middle of the floor, and wen to sleep by 6 PM. No internet access in the rooms. The other Japanese gust appears to have a great time and the breakfast was fantastic. There was one hotel staff who took me down beyond the train station to the 7-Eleven, which was the only place were one could get Yen. Nikko was very interesting, and there were may foreigners, but everything was in Japanese and only a few people spoke a little english and all instructions were in Japanese.
